Output 28a15add66cd7b7da75bec5adad49479c6df25b040f3eda97e48c22ce2329a2b:0

value
65759996
script pubkey
OP_0 OP_PUSHBYTES_20 10364c13e9897e3200dde37fc02a599359cdeb75
address
ltc1qzqmycylf39lryqxaudluq2jejdvum6m4f4ae2r
transaction
28a15add66cd7b7da75bec5adad49479c6df25b040f3eda97e48c22ce2329a2b
spent
true